Position Summary

The Enrollment Counselor (EC) is responsible for recruiting and enrolling qualified new students for Stevenson University Online (SUO) degree and certificate programs. The EC is assigned a portfolio of academic programs and is cross-trained to provide recruiting, admissions, and enrollment support for all SUO programs. This position requires strong interpersonal skills and a sales mindset, and responsibilities include, but are not limited to, contacting prospective students who have expressed an interest SUO programs;

providing effective, regular, responsive, and proactive guidance to prospective students to support their enrollment in SUO; representing SUO at recruitment events, fairs, and other related activities on-campus, off-campus, and virtually to generate student leads; maintaining professional relationships that support the generation of students leads and enrollment; and supporting the planning and execution of marketing, admissions, and other events related to SUO, including the Bachelor's to Master's option.

Meeting established performance metrics is expected. The Enrollment Counselor tracks and collects relevant data and compiles regular and ad hoc reports as assigned. This position is campus-based and housed on the university’s Greenspring campus. The Enrollment Counselor works as a member of the team to support overall SUO operations and supports initiatives as requested.

Essential Functions
  • Learn and maintain current knowledge of SUO academic programs, activities, scholarships, partnerships, discounts, and other relevant information.
  • Recruit, admit, and enroll prospective students in an assigned portfolio of SUO academic programs to meet or exceed established performance metrics and goals.
  • Provide excellent customer service to ensure student satisfaction throughout the recruitment, admission, and enrollment process.
  • Generate prospective student leads by representing SUO at recruitment events, fairs, and other related activities held on-campus, off-campus, and/or virtually.
  • Contact prospective students who have expressed interest in SUO programs and provide proactive guidance to secure their completed application and enrollment.
  • Review assigned student applications for admission, verify and evaluate credentials, and recommend admission decisions based on institutional guidelines.
  • Track and collect relevant data and compile regular and ad hoc reports as assigned.
  • Plan and execute marketing, admissions, and other events related to the Bachelor's to Master's option, in collaboration with academic program administrators and deans.
  • Attend, plan, and coordinate recruiting events for online students, including information sessions, open houses, and webinars.
  • Maintain an active contact database and identify new opportunities to enhance enrollment in SUO programs.
  • Cross-train and serve as backup for recruiting, admitting, and enrolling prospective students across all SUO academic programs.
  • Assist with implementing standard and e-marketing strategies and ensure recruiting materials stay aligned with academic programs.
  • Maintain confidential records in accordance with the Family Educational Rights and Privacy Act (FERPA).
  • Monitor inquiry, admission, and enrollment trends and report findings to the Senior Director.
Education/Experience

Bachelor's degree required. Experience in higher education admissions preferred. Valid driver's license with good driving record; must be insurable.
